Who We Are 

North American Lighting Inc., member of the Koito Group of Companies, is the largest tier one automotive exterior lighting manufacturer in North America. As the market share leader in exterior automotive lighting, NAL provides advanced lighting technology, engineering design expertise, and state-of-the-art production capabilities to auto makers based in North America and around the world.  

  

Our Opportunity 

North American Lighting (NAL) is looking for a Production Control Planner - I to join our team. The ideal candidate will plan, organize, and execute production schedules for assigned product lines to achieve maximum customer satisfaction levels and “on-time” shipments. 

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

Your Priorities 

  • Develops and maintains master schedules and order releases required to support customer requirements for assigned product lines. 
  • Reviews machine capacity, maintenance requirements, and schedules to determine if production plans for assigned product lines are achievable. 
  • Monitors status of purchase parts and communicates any changes to purchasing department. 
  • Works with Purchasing to secure purchase parts needed to meet production schedules. 
  • Provides shipping dates for short lead orders based on material availability and production capacity. 
  • Determines and maintains required Kanban card levels within the production system to meet production schedules and inventory targets. 

Requirements

Your Background 

High School Diploma or GED, plus 2 to 4 years of progressive manufacturing experience. 

Associate's Degree in Business or a related discipline, Experience with computerized material requirements planning, and Access and Crystal Reports skills are preferred.
